Virginia's retrocession of the land it originally ceded for the creation of Washington, D.C., means that in 1846, the U.S. Congress returned the portion of the District that had been Virginia's back to the state. This decision was largely influenced by local opposition to the federal government's control over the area and the desire for local governance. As a result, the current boundaries of Washington, D.C., were established, with only the land originally ceded by Maryland remaining. This action reflects historical tensions over federal and state authority.

Did the puritans or pilgrims mean to land in Virginia?

The Pilgrims, who were a group of Separatist Puritans, intended to land in Virginia but were blown off course during their journey across the Atlantic. Instead, they arrived in what is now Massachusetts in 1620, where they established Plymouth Colony. While they had hoped to settle within the bounds of the Virginia Company's territory, their unexpected landing led to the creation of a new colony and the development of their own governance, as outlined in the Mayflower Compact.
